Uzbekistan's TMK Lists 31 Critical Raw Materials to Advance Mineral Strategy
en.Wedoany.com Reported - Amir Abidov, a senior executive at the Uzbekistan Technological Metals Complex (TMK), stated this month that the modernized mining and green metal technology industrial park is a key industrial component of "New Uzbekistan," which he described as a "flagship industry" within the country's 2030 economic growth strategy, a strategy advancing at a remarkable pace.
Abidov, TMK's Deputy General Manager for New Technology Development, Innovation, and Artificial Intelligence, said the country has listed 31 critical raw materials. The critical raw materials strategy was formulated by President Shavkat Mirziyoyev. Abidov stated that he is the executor of this strategy, with the goal of transforming these raw materials into finished products.
Uzbekistan is investing billions of dollars in a national development plan aimed at elevating the country, classified by the World Bank as lower-middle income with a population of approximately 39 million, to an upper-middle-income nation. Near-term targets include expanding the GDP from $145 billion to over $240 billion by 2030 and increasing per capita GDP by 160%. Earlier this year, the World Bank ranked Uzbekistan as one of the fastest-growing emerging economies in Europe and Central Asia. Real GDP grew a record 7.7% in 2025, and the World Bank projects 6.4% growth this year.
Like neighboring Kazakhstan, Uzbekistan is resource-rich. Abidov stated that the focus is not only on increasing output of minerals such as tungsten, gold, silver, copper, molybdenum, rhenium, selenium, lithium, cadmium, and rare earths, but more importantly on building a vertical value chain that delivers "finished products" and integrating them with domestic manufacturing and other industries. The national strategy has accelerated engagement with international manufacturers, financiers, governments, and technology companies. Abidov noted that in one of only two doubly landlocked countries globally, adopting a "multi-vector" approach to attract partners, capital, and innovation is crucial for sustainable economic development. He believes that building internal capacity—from scientific and engineering skills to viable industries at the top of the value chain—is the true key to the nation's long-term prosperity.
The multi-vector policy means not relying on a single source. China is adept at and quick to build factories and provide financing, doing so very rapidly. Europe excels in technology, with international European standards being very high-quality and green. The United States is strong in financing and offtake contracts. However, the drawback of a single approach is inconsistency. For example, the Chinese are good at building factories quickly, but technology transfer is limited. The technology is viable, but human capital is also needed. Engineers need to design new factories based on the best knowledge. It's not just about money and proven technology; it also involves advanced technology and a complete value chain. For instance, to produce semiconductor-grade selenium, one cannot simply purchase and use technical-grade selenium directly; that is variable technology. One must start upstream and build the entire chain to match the final product. The U.S. has cooperation in technology, but rare earth technology is more developed in Europe and China, so all gaps need to be filled. The multi-vector approach means obtaining inputs from the entire value chain to improve the mining and metals industry and other sectors.
TMK was established in 2024, originating from the state-owned Almalyk Mining and Metallurgical Combine, serving as a national vehicle to drive growth in raw material output and build a vertical value chain. Abidov stated that the centralized structure enables TMK to plan and execute strategically and rapidly. The company is keen to leverage Uzbekistan's aggressive renewable energy buildout: the country, historically reliant on natural gas, now generates one-third of its electricity from renewables. He said, "You cannot produce green metals without green technology. So we are producing green metals and using the energy transition to achieve this."
TMK has established three "technology industrial parks" centered on metal processing in Chirchik, Ohangaron, and Jizzakh. These industrial zones are seeking to increase residents or tenants and expand deep processing, advanced manufacturing, and R&D capabilities. All tax incentives and regulations have already been established for this purpose. Internal demand is also being created, with electric vehicles currently being produced in the Jizzakh region. China's BYD is exploring expanding electric vehicle production at its factory opened in 2024 in partnership with Uzbekistan's state-owned Uzavtosanoat JSC. The Jizzakh plant currently employs around 1,200 people and could eventually provide up to 10,000 jobs. TMK will also launch a new factory in November producing powder metallurgy-based powertrain components, resulting from a technology transfer with South Korean partner Korea Powder Metallurgy.
